Description

Perched atop Snowmass Mountain, this residence is positioned to take full advantage of its alpine setting, where daily life unfolds directly into the surrounding mountain landscape. Ski access out the door, with direct routes to the Two Creeks lift in the winter months, and immediate connectivity to hiking and biking trails that extend into the surrounding wilderness through the warmer seasons.The home offers rare east-facing views, capturing expansive, long-range vistas across the valley and surrounding peaks. Morning light fills each room, creating a quiet sense of connection to the landscape that defines life at elevation.Tucked within a small cul-de-sac of only 6 homes and set apart from through-streets, the setting offers a rare sense of privacy. The home sits quietly within its natural surroundings, where daily life is shared with the rhythm of the mountain and its wildlife--deer moving through the landscape and foxes at dawn.Comprehensively remodeled inside and out in 2026, the interiors reflect a European chalet influence, thoughtfully executed by interior designer Kristin Dittmar. The home was constructed and refined using a palette of enduring, natural materials--built-in stone, aged white brass, pewter, hand-hewn wood, and zellige tile--creating a tactile sense of permanence and quiet sophistication. The result is a cohesive environment designed to feel settled, requiring little reinvention over time.Wellness is integrated into the architecture of the home. An above-grade fitness room, sauna, and outdoor jacuzzi provide a private retreat after time spent on the mountain. The primary suite functions as its own calm enclosure, with a spa-like bath that emphasizes simplicity, scale, and comfort.The floor plan offers five bedrooms and bathrooms plus a powder room, with generous proportions throughout. A separate living area with kitchenette provides flexibility for guests or extended stays, while maintaining privacy from the main living spaces.Practical mountain living is addressed with equal care. A three-car garage accommodates vehicles and mountain equipment, complemented by a snowmelt driveway designed for ease through winter conditions. A dedicated mudroom with built-in lockers connects directly from the garage, with additional ski and sports storage located downstairs to support an active alpine lifestyle.The experience of the home is defined less by its individual features than by its rhythm--quiet mornings with shifting light across the peaks, direct access to the mountain without transition, and spaces designed to support both retreat and activity within the same setting.
